The first convicts to arrive in Van Diemen's Land, were worked like slaves to provide timber needed for the fledgling settlements. WebbThe Flowerdale River comprises the largest tributary system on the Inglis and rises from the northern end of the Campbell Range near West Takone. It drains an area of 161 km2 (approximately a third of the Inglis River catchment), contributes nearly half the yield over its 65 km length, and discharges into the Inglis River at Flowerdale.
